Chapter 126 Visit

A few more days passed, and it was the first day off after school started. Chen Chuan also went back to his aunt's house.

Nian Fuli was also at home this time. When he entered the door, he was sitting in a recliner, listening to the radio and reading the newspaper with his legs crossed, while his two cousins ​​were playing happily on the side.

Chen Chuan greeted the two of them and went to get some water.

Nian Fuli looked at Chen Chuan, then at Yu Wan, touched his chest, and said, "I've finished my cigarette. Yu Wan, go buy me a pack of cigarettes."

Yu Wan glanced at him and said to Chen Chuan: "Look, your uncle is the team leader now, and he can give orders to people."

Nian Fuli was a little helpless. "It's just a pack of cigarettes. Why are you saying that? Even if I were the team leader, I could only have one pack a day..."

"Okay, Captain Nian, I'll buy it for you right away."

After Yu Wan left, Nian Fuli put down the newspaper, got up, and sent his cousins ​​off to play in their rooms. Then he came back and said to Chen Chuan, "Xiao Chuan, I heard you were the one who knocked down that Maca guy? Were you there at the time?"

Chen Chuan said, "Yes, uncle. It was an event arranged by the school. I was there when the shooting happened. I wonder how Director Liu is doing?"

Nian Fuli said, "There's no need to worry about them. The officials in the Government Affairs Department all wear protective clothing before going out. Liu Zhan was just a little frightened, he's not seriously injured. But because of this matter, the brothers in the bureau have been busy again..."

After hearing what he said, Chen Chuan realized that there were actually more than one place attacked that day. It was obvious that the attack was intended to divert the police force. He asked again, "Uncle, I wonder what will happen to those Maca students?"

Nian Fuli said: "How should we deal with it? Just follow the normal procedures for fugitives in exile."

"Exiled fugitives?" Chen Chuan was surprised. "Aren't they exchange students?"

Nian Fuli said, "The higher-ups have found out that these people are not exchange students, but a group of exiles from Maca. The real exchange students claimed that they were attacked by these people when they entered Dashun, and replaced them to participate in the exchange activities at Wuyi College."

"Is that so..."

Chen Chuan thought for a moment. Judging from the performance of Teacher Duma and those students, they were serious students and teachers, and they had received a long period of combat training, otherwise Wu Yi would not be unable to tell the difference.

So he guessed in his heart that the Maka people might have made a conscious exchange in order to avoid giving anyone a pretext to ruin diplomatic relations with Dashun, and at the same time not to be dragged into the water by the resistance organization.

It's true that this is an explanation on the surface. On the surface, it even seems that the Maca exchange group is the aggrieved party, because those fugitives have long been stripped of their citizenship and are no longer considered Maca people.

But no one is a fool. It should not be difficult to figure out what is going on. If the Maca people really arranged it this way on purpose, then Dashun and Maca may be able to maintain their relationship on the surface, but they will definitely not be able to go back to the way they were in private.

He then asked, "Uncle, where are the students who escaped with their belongings that day?"

Nian Fuli said, "They are currently missing. They must be being contacted by someone. The resistance group that has appeared this time is highly regarded by the Government Affairs Office. It's very likely that they took advantage of Fang Dawei's group's failure to cause trouble last time and are taking advantage of this opportunity to reappear."

As he spoke, he took out half a pack of cigarettes, lit one, took a puff, and said with emotion: "The brothers in the patrol bureau are busy talking and running around. They have to work hard again."

Chen Chuanxin said, "Okay, uncle, your status is so high, and your ideological realm is really different."

After taking a few puffs, Nian Fuli suddenly thought of something. He glanced outside, quickly put out his cigarette, and quickly opened the window to let in some fresh air. He turned back and said to Zhengse, "Don't tell your aunt that you were there, or she'll worry again."

Chen Chuan smiled and said, "Don't worry, uncle, I won't tell my aunt about this."

After having lunch at home at noon, Chen Chuan planned to go and meet Cheng Zitong’s nephew, a senior sister named He Nan.

Although he had never met this senior sister, he had worked with her apprentice Lin Xiaodi when he was assigned by Ren Xiaotian.

Because this was not an assigned task, he did not choose to call a car from the commissioned company. After the phone call, he went to the city center and took the tram to Senior Sister He Nan's place in the south of the city.

This was a training hall located on the banks of the Baihe River in the south of the city. Rows of willow trees lined the riverbank, and their buds were now sprouting, adding a touch of color. Arriving at the training hall, a man who looked like an attendant emerged and said respectfully, "Master Chen, right? The young lady is waiting for you. Please follow me."

Chen Chuan thanked him and followed him inside. It was clearly a place for practicing martial arts. The road leading to the venue was paved with smooth pebbles, but both sides of the hall were lined with flower stands and potted plants, with a faint green and full of vitality.

When I arrived at the outer hall, I smelled a refreshing fragrance, which felt very comfortable. Through the hollow flower screen, I could see a woman cutting flowers under the window, and a long sword seemed to be hanging on the side within reach.

The attendant walked in and said something, then she put down her things, went to the basin beside to wash her hands, wiped them clean, stroked her hair, and walked out.

When Chen Chuan saw someone coming out, he took a look at her. She was a beautiful woman in her early thirties, with an oval face, curved eyebrows, and an intellectual and elegant temperament. She had her hair tied in a bun at the back of her head and was wearing a modified jade-white training suit with a slim waist.

If it weren't for the fact that her steps were extremely rhythmic and there was a hint of strength when she landed, her face wouldn't look like a fighter.

He clasped his fists and saluted, saying, "Is this Senior Sister He?"

Senior Sister He smiled. "You're really my Uncle Cheng's student. You're so young, but don't be as old-fashioned as my uncle." She walked over and extended her hand to shake Chen Chuan's. "Xiao Di told me about you last time. She said Uncle Cheng's student was a good-looking guy. Hmm, that's great. Come in and sit down."

She brought Chen Chuan inside, and under the stained glass window, they sat down on antique sandalwood chairs and had someone brew a cup of fragrant tea.

Chen Chuan felt that the layout here was very exquisite, the color tone and environment made people feel very comfortable, and every utensil was very exquisite. It seemed that this Senior Sister He was a person who liked a refined life.

Senior Sister He sat in a dignified position, her back straight, her hands on her stomach. She said, "Master Cheng had already called me before. This matter has been bothering Lao Lei for a long time, but Lao Lei doesn't like to owe favors to others. If he doesn't ask, I'd be too embarrassed to go to Master Cheng. It's really great that Master Cheng is willing to help this time. It really relieves a worry for me."

When Chen Chuan heard this, he knew that this senior sister might have misunderstood. She might have thought that Cheng Zitong was willing to help solve the problem encountered by Director Lei’s son, and that he, as a student, was only there to serve as a link.

However, he did not say it out loud. Cheng Zitong did not say this, so he naturally had his reasons. On the contrary, when Senior Sister He spoke of Director Lei, her tone was casual and concerned, and it was obvious that the two of them had a very close relationship.

He said, "Sister, when would it be convenient for me to meet Director Lei?"

Senior Sister He said, "You're still a student, right? You're so busy with schoolwork, it's not easy for you to find time to come here. Thank you, Senior Sister. Today is a day off, and Lao Lei happens to be home. I've already said hello to him. Well, you can take my car."

Chen Chuanshuo said, "Thank you, Senior Sister."

Senior Sister He smiled and said, "Junior Brother Chen, you came specially to help Lao Lei solve the problem, so I want to thank you."

Chen Chuan walked out without saying a word to her and got into a light blue Yu Fulan car. It can be seen that this Senior Sister He came from a well-off family and lived in the south of the city. She had a special car and driver to pick her up.

After getting in the car, it drove south. The speed was not slow, but it was very steady. After about thirty minutes, we arrived at the edge of the Quanzhou area. We were almost out of the city. Judging from the location, this place was in the southwest corner of Yangzhi City. There were not many residential houses around, but they were all two- or three-story buildings. There was one building every few meters, which seemed very secluded.

He asked the driver, "Master, does Director Lei live nearby?"

The driver explained: "Director Lei doesn't like living in crowded places."

After driving for another five or six minutes, the car turned onto a tree-lined avenue and stopped in front of a three-story building surrounded by a flower garden. The driver said, "We're here."

Chen Chuan got out of the car and saw many gorgeous flowers and plants planted in the flower garden. He couldn't tell the names of them. They might be foreign varieties, or they might be specially cultivated. You have to know that it was February, and it was not easy to make them so bright and eye-catching.

Looking at these things, the figure of Senior Sister He appeared in his mind. He couldn't explain why, but he just felt that these flowers and plants were related to this person.

After greeting the driver, he walked along the clean path to the steps outside the door, walked under an awning, and knocked on the door.

After waiting for a while, I heard footsteps approaching and the door opened from the inside. A man who was no more than forty years old came out. He wore black-framed glasses, a gray-black jacket with a white shirt underneath, a straight nose and a square mouth, and had a handsome appearance.

Chen Chuan was unsure of his identity and said, "Hello, is this Director Lei's home? I'm looking for Director Lei."

The man nodded and said, "That's me. Did she ask you to come?" After Chen Chuan nodded, he politely said, "Excuse me for coming here." He turned and walked inside, "Come in and sit down."

Chen Chuan looked at him. Director Lei did not look like an official from the Government Affairs Department, but more like a teacher. He changed his shoes at the door and walked in.

When they got inside, Director Lei was very polite even to a young man like him. He asked him to sit on the sofa, poured him a glass of water, and said, "Have you asked for anything yet?"

Chen Chuan said: "Chen Chuan, a student of Wuyi College."

Director Lei was a little surprised and looked at him twice. "Oh? He Nan only said that you were Director Cheng's apprentice, but didn't say that you were Wu Yi's student."

Apprentices and students are different, but when Chen Chuan heard him say this, he knew that it was obvious that Senior Sister He wanted to emphasize the relationship between him and Cheng Zitong, so he did not rush to deny it.

"Chen Chuan..." Director Lei pondered the name. "I think I've heard of this name." He raised his head, his eyes behind his glasses sharpening. "Five days ago, was it you who intercepted and killed the Maka fugitive Duma?"

Chen Chuan didn't expect that he knew about this, because officials from the Government Affairs Department generally don't care about specific people and things below them. He said, "It's me. I didn't expect Director Lei to know about this too."

Director Lei looked at him and said, "As a Wu Yi student, not on-site security, you don't have to take the lead in those things. Why did you take the initiative to do it?"

Chen Chuanshuo said: "I didn't intend to speak out, but someone was shooting innocent civilians at the scene. No matter who I am, as long as I have the ability, I can't just sit back and watch."

Director Lei nodded and commented, "You have a strong sense of justice."

Chen Chuan said frankly, "Not only that, I'm a native of Yangzhi City, and my friends and family are all here. What if they happen to be among those people?"

Director Lei's gaze on him softened. He was silent for a moment, then suddenly said, "Go back."

Chen Chuan was startled and said, "Director Lei?"

Director Lei shook his head and said, "I've thought of many ways to deal with my son's situation. Whether or not it can be resolved is not the question at hand, but it could easily spread to others and cause other troubles. You're a good young man with a bright future. You shouldn't be dragged into this matter."

Chen Chuan thought for a moment and said, "Director Lei, my teacher asked me to come because he trusted my ability."

Director Lei was a little surprised because Chen Chuan emphasized himself instead of his teacher. He pushed his glasses and looked at Chen Chuan carefully. After a while, he nodded and stood up. "Come with me."

Chen Chuan followed him up the stairs to the third floor. Director Lei took out his key, opened the door, and whispered to a child huddled in the corner, "That's my son. He's very afraid of strangers. If you have any questions, please be gentle."

Chen Chuan nodded and walked towards it. When he got close, he paused slightly and looked back at Director Lei. Director Lei said in a natural tone, "What's wrong? Is there something wrong?"

"Nothing..." Chen Chuan looked at the child again, it was just... a puppet.
